Best Schools in Hilliard, OH
Hilliard, OH has a total of 32 schools including 6 high schools, 7 middle schools and 19 elementary schools. A total of 20,679 students attend Hilliard, OH schools. On average, schools in Hilliard score 58% on their proficiency tests, and we project an average score of 54%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, schools in Hilliard exceed exp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in Hilliard, OH
City-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.
Community Factors
Hilliard, OH has a total population of 67,895 with 28%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 96%, and 56%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
